  • Page 4 The Headset Ear Cups must be fitted over your ears covering and enclosing them completely The Headset should be fitted so that the horizontal axis of the Ear Cup bisects the approximate tip of the nose of the wearer. This usually means the Headband of the headset will be located directly above the ears, however the headband may be adjusted slightly forward or rearwards for maximum comfort.
  • Page 5 The Microphone Boom can be further adjusted so that the Microphone element (Figure C, item 7) can be correctly positioned in the centre of the mouth opening. Move the ball joint at the mid point of the Microphone Boom to shape the Boom as required. Also, the screw at the Microphone element can be loosened by half a turn counter clockwise to adjust it’s angle.
  • Page 6 STEP 4 Ensuring Ear Cups seal against your head Placing one hand against each Ear Cup, firmly p both Ear Cups inwards against your head and hold for 2 seconds. This action moulds and helps the Ea Cushions to form an efficient seal against the head around your ears improving both comfort and hearing protection.

    PARTS REPLACEMENT (See items 1 – 4 pictured in Figure 6.0) The LEATHER HEAD BAND COVER (item 1) is simply wrapped around the Head Band with the edges overlapping so that the Velcro seam can be evenly pressed together. To remove the cover, pull the top overlap away from the bottom at the Velcro seam.
